Managed-WP.™

Rognone 插件中的关键 XSS 漏洞 | CVE20261450 | 2026-06-02


插件名称 rognone
漏洞类型 跨站点脚本 (XSS)
CVE编号 CVE-2026-1450
紧急 中等的
CVE 发布日期 2026-06-02
源网址 CVE-2026-1450

关键安全警报:rognone(<= 0.6.2)中的反射型XSS漏洞 — WordPress网站所有者的立即修复指南

日期: 2026年6月2日
严重程度: 中等(CVSS 7.1) — CVE-2026-1450
受影响的软件: WordPress 插件 rognone — 版本最高至0.6.2
研究资料来源: san6051 / COFFSec

如果您的WordPress网站使用 rognone 插件版本0.6.2或更早版本,采取立即的安全预防措施至关重要。已识别出一个反射型跨站脚本(XSS)漏洞,允许未经身份验证的威胁行为者构造恶意URL,当管理员或特权用户访问时,会在该用户的浏览器中执行任意JavaScript。此缺陷可能导致会话劫持、管理员账户接管和恶意负载的传播。.

以下是专家分析,详细说明了漏洞、攻击向量、检测方法和可操作的缓解步骤,以安全优先的美国专家语气,针对管理WordPress环境的网站管理员和IT安全专业人员量身定制。此建议代表Managed-WP对处理此关键WordPress插件漏洞的权威观点。.


执行摘要

  • 识别的问题:rognone 插件(最高至v0.6.2)存在反射型XSS漏洞(CVE-2026-1450)。恶意输入未被正确清理,允许通过构造的URL进行脚本注入。.
  • 受影响方: 使用易受攻击版本的WordPress网站受到针对特权用户(管理员)的攻击。.
  • 风险等级: 中等。利用此漏洞需要管理员与恶意链接互动。影响范围从会话盗窃到完全的管理员控制和网站妥协。.
  • 立即采取的建议措施: 在等待安全补丁的情况下,停用或移除该插件。或者,应用防火墙级别的虚拟补丁,限制管理员访问,并强制实施强用户账户保护。.
  • 长期策略: 转向维护良好且安全的替代插件,实施分层的网络安全,包括内容安全策略(CSP)、Web应用防火墙(WAF)和持续监控。.

理解WordPress上下文中的反射型XSS

反射型跨站脚本是一种漏洞,其中来自用户提供的数据(如URL参数)的未清理输入立即在网页中回显,允许注入的JavaScript在受信任网站的上下文中执行。.

为什么这个威胁对WordPress网站来说很严重:

  • 管理员浏览器被高度信任,并携带身份验证令牌和提升的API权限。.
  • 注入的脚本可以劫持会话、操纵站点设置、创建恶意管理员账户或引入恶意软件。.
  • 尽管是短暂的,反射型XSS很容易通过钓鱼链接武器化,使其成为自动化或针对性攻击的常见途径。.

rognone漏洞的详细信息

  • 受影响版本: ≤ 0.6.2
  • 漏洞类型: 反射型跨站脚本攻击(XSS)
  • CVE标识符: CVE-2026-1450
  • 所需权限: 无需制作攻击URL;受害者必须是点击它的特权用户。.
  • CVSS评分: 7.1(中等严重性)

此漏洞允许攻击者利用社会工程学(例如,钓鱼邮件、论坛帖子)诱使管理员用户访问旨在执行任意脚本的恶意URL。.


潜在攻击场景

  1. 管理会话劫持: 攻击者诱使管理员访问一个精心制作的URL,从而窃取会话cookie或劫持仪表板访问。.
  2. 恶意软件植入与网站篡改: 恶意JavaScript可以更改网站内容或上传后门,促进持续的妥协。.
  3. 供应链和横向移动: 如果与外部API/服务集成,泄露的凭据可能会泄漏给第三方,加深影响。.

攻击者大量利用钓鱼活动进行大规模利用;没有任何WordPress网站或管理员仅因流量量而免受影响。.


识别剥削迹象

  • 来自未知IP或奇怪时间的异常管理员登录模式。.
  • 用户账户的意外创建或提升。.
  • 核心、插件或主题文件的修改时间戳没有经过授权的更改。.
  • 帖子、页面或模板中存在可疑的脚本或注入内容。.
  • 服务器日志显示带有可疑有效负载的长查询字符串(<script>, onload=, javascript:).
  • 防火墙或恶意软件扫描器对被阻止或检测到的攻击签名发出警报。.

观察这些指标的任何激增作为潜在的违规行为,并立即响应。.


立即采取的缓解措施

  1. 停用或移除 rognone
    在安全更新发布之前禁用易受攻击的插件。.
  2. 限制管理访问
    限制 /wp-admin//wp-login.php 通过 IP 白名单或 HTTP 基本认证。.
  3. 强制凭证轮换
    重置所有管理员密码,并通过更新盐值使活动会话失效。 wp-config.php.
  4. 强制实施多因素认证 (MFA)
    对所有具有提升权限的用户要求MFA。.
  5. 在 WAF 层应用虚拟补丁
    部署规则以阻止查询字符串和请求体中的典型反射 XSS 有效负载。.
  6. 实施内容安全策略 (CSP)
    添加 CSP 头以限制脚本执行到受信任的来源。.
  7. 运行全面的网站扫描
    使用恶意软件和文件完整性扫描器定位妥协。.
  8. 如果被妥协,从干净的备份中恢复
    仅在缓解步骤到位后恢复。.

如果插件移除暂时不可行,请确保至少防火墙级别的保护和管理员访问限制立即生效。.


WAF / 虚拟补丁的示例规则

这里有一些示例 WAF 规则,旨在检测和阻止常见的反射 XSS 攻击有效负载。这些提供了中级缓解,但不能替代插件补丁的必要性。.

# 阻止 GET/POST 参数中的  标签"

if ($arg_filename ~* "\.\./|") { 检查查询字符串中的可疑令牌,并使用 NGINX Lua 或 WordPress 防火墙插件相应地拒绝访问。.


内容安全策略(CSP)指南

CSP 通过限制允许的脚本来源和禁用内联 JavaScript 来帮助减轻 XSS 影响。虽然 CSP 并不能修复根本原因,但它限制了注入脚本造成的损害。.

内容安全策略:默认源 'self';脚本源 'self' 'nonce-';对象源 'none';基本 URI 'self';框架祖先 'none';报告 URI https://yourdomain.com/csp-report-endpoint
  • 避免 ''unsafe-inline''.
  • 对内联脚本使用随机数或哈希。.
  • 首先在 仅报告 模式中测试策略。.
  • 收集违规报告以进行调整和执行。.

注意:某些管理界面可能依赖于内联脚本,因此请在暂存环境中验证功能影响。.


开发者修复步骤

插件作者和维护者应立即:

  1. 正确转义所有输出
    如果您维护站点代码,请使用WordPress转义函数(esc_html(), esc_attr(), esc_url()) 在输出数据之前适当地。.
  2. 彻底清理输入
    对所有用户输入应用正确的清理 (sanitize_text_field(), wp_kses_post(), 等等。).
  3. 验证能力并使用随机数
    确保用户权限检查 (当前用户可以()) 和 nonce 验证 (wp_verify_nonce())用于敏感操作。
  4. 防止原始输入反射
    永远不要直接回显用户输入而不进行编码和清理。.
  5. 对数据库查询使用预处理语句
    避免 SQL 注入和数据损坏。.
  6. 添加自动化测试
    包括单元和集成测试,以验证对 XSS 输入的行为。.

安全输出处理的示例:

<?php

如果补丁无法快速交付,请将插件标记为不安全并从活动使用中移除。.


疑似入侵事件响应检查清单

  1. 隔离该站点
    将网站置于维护模式或暂时下线。.
  2. 捕获取证数据
    保留服务器日志、数据库快照和 WordPress 日志以供分析。.
  3. 扫描和识别
    检查文件完整性和用户帐户是否有未经授权的更改或恶意软件。.
  4. 重置密钥
    更新密码、API 密钥和安全盐。.
  5. 清理或恢复
    一旦漏洞得到解决,从经过验证的干净备份中恢复。.
  6. 从可信来源重新安装
    用官方副本替换 WordPress 核心、主题和插件。.
  7. 启用持续监控
    实施警报和 WAF 保护措施。.
  8. 分享妥协指标 (IOC)
    如果管理多个网站,请传播情报以进行更广泛的防御。.

加强对 XSS 威胁的防御

  • 移除不必要的插件/主题。.
  • 将最小权限原则应用于管理员权限。.
  • 强制使用强密码,并要求所有特权用户启用多因素认证(MFA)。.
  • 对所有用户生成的内容应用严格的清理。.
  • 保持 WordPress 核心代码、插件和主题的最新版本。
  • 定期备份网站并验证恢复流程。
  • 采用分层安全措施:WAF、CSP、恶意软件扫描器、文件完整性监控。.

Managed-WP 如何保护 WordPress 网站免受反射型 XSS 攻击

Managed-WP 在现实假设下运营,认为所有软件都可能存在漏洞,并提供以下分层防御:

  • 主动的 Managed WAF 规则,能够快速适应新的漏洞披露,如反射型 XSS。.
  • 虚拟补丁技术在漏洞插件代码之前拦截攻击尝试。.
  • 持续的恶意软件扫描和自动修复服务,以检测和删除恶意内容。.
  • 针对可疑用户和系统活动的行为异常检测监控。.
  • 安全加固检查清单,包括实施 CSP 和保护管理入口点的协助。.
  • 实时监控、事件警报和专家修复支持,以实现企业级响应能力。.

即使在补丁可用之前,Managed-WP 的防御系统也提供关键保护,以降低风险和停机时间。.


今天就开始使用 Managed-WP 的免费基础计划

对于寻求基础安全覆盖的 WordPress 网站,Managed-WP 的免费基础计划包括:

  • 自动 WAF 规则更新,以阻止常见的利用模式。.
  • 通过我们的防火墙提供无限带宽保护。.
  • 全面的 Web 应用防火墙覆盖,防御 OWASP 前 10 大攻击向量。.
  • 恶意软件扫描以检测注入的脚本和可疑文件。.
  • 与最佳安全实践一致的核心风险缓解。.

请在此注册: https://managed-wp.com/pricing


长期加固检查清单

  • 停用并移除 rognone 如果使用版本 0.6.2 或更早版本,除非发布了安全版本。.
  • 利用带有虚拟补丁规则的托管 WAF,针对 XSS 攻击向量。.
  • 通过 IP 或 HTTP 基本身份验证限制对 WordPress 管理界面的访问。.
  • 为所有特权账户启用多因素身份验证。
  • 强制重置密码,并定期轮换 API 密钥和安全盐。.
  • 实施并强制执行内容安全策略,以控制脚本执行。.
  • 定期进行全站恶意软件扫描和文件完整性验证。.
  • 分析服务器和应用程序日志以查找可疑请求模式。.
  • 对所有自定义 WordPress 代码应用安全编码实践:彻底清理输入并转义输出。.
  • 定期维护和更新 WordPress 核心、插件和主题,同时删除未使用的组件。.
  • 采用持续安全监控,并考虑使用托管安全服务以快速响应。.

技术参考:WordPress 安全转义和清理方法

  • HTML 输出: esc_html( $字符串 )
  • 属性: esc_attr( $字符串 )
  • 网址: esc_url( $网址 )
  • 数据库查询: $wpdb->prepare()
  • 文本字段: sanitize_text_field( $text )
  • 允许的 HTML: wp_kses( $string, $allowed_html_array )
  • 清理后的帖子内容: wp_kses_post( $content )

演示清理和转义的代码示例:

&lt;?php

结束语:将每个 WordPress 漏洞视为时间紧迫

反射型 XSS 漏洞可能看起来表面,但当特权用户受到攻击时会导致严重后果。由于利用依赖于欺骗管理员点击恶意内容,因此用户教育和多方面的防御至关重要。.

如果您的 WordPress 部署使用 rognone (≤0.6.2),请果断行动:移除或停用该插件,激活 WAF 虚拟补丁,重置用户凭据,并检查您的网站是否有被攻破的证据。Managed-WP 在这个关键时刻为您提供快速的多层保护和专家协助。.

请记住——您的管理员用户是您网站安全的守门人。请相应地保护他们。.


采取积极措施——使用 Managed-WP 保护您的网站

不要因为忽略插件缺陷或权限不足而危及您的业务或声誉。Managed-WP 提供强大的 Web 应用程序防火墙 (WAF) 保护、量身定制的漏洞响应以及 WordPress 安全方面的专业修复,远超标准主机服务。

博客读者专享优惠: 加入我们的 MWPv1r1 保护计划——行业级安全保障,每月仅需 20 美元起。

  • 自动化虚拟补丁和高级基于角色的流量过滤
  • 个性化入职流程和分步网站安全检查清单
  • 实时监控、事件警报和优先补救支持
  • 可操作的机密管理和角色强化最佳实践指南

轻松上手——每月只需 20 美元即可保护您的网站:
使用 Managed-WP MWPv1r1 计划保护我的网站

为什么信任 Managed-WP?

  • 立即覆盖新发现的插件和主题漏洞
  • 针对高风险场景的自定义 WAF 规则和即时虚拟补丁
  • 随时为您提供专属礼宾服务、专家级解决方案和最佳实践建议

不要等到下一次安全漏洞出现才采取行动。使用 Managed-WP 保护您的 WordPress 网站和声誉——这是重视安全性的企业的首选。

点击上方链接即可立即开始您的保护(MWPv1r1 计划,每月 20 美元)。
https://managed-wp.com/pricing


热门文章